Wordnet-LMF has been proposed in the context of the EU KYOTO project as
an LMF format for wordnets. It is fully compatible with the Lexical Markup Framework (LMF),
a published ISO standard (ISO-24613) for encoding lexical resources.
The conversion of GermaNet into Wordnet-LMF resulted within the context of our work on
Standardizing Wordnets in the ISO Standard LMF: Wordnet-LMF for GermaNet (see reference below).
In our paper (see reference below), we propose a number of crucial modifications and a set of
extensions to Wordnet-LMF that are needed for conversion of wordnets in general and for
conversion of GermaNet in particular.
There are two XQuery scripts for converting GermaNet to
Wordnet-LMF available: one that results in the unmodified version of Wordnet-LMF (as it was
proposed by the KYOTO project), and another that results in a revised version of Wordnet-LMF
as proposed in our paper.
